Denise Van Outen weds her technicolour dreamboat in secret Seychelles ceremony

Friends were beginning to fear Denise Van Outen’s long-cherished wish to settle down and start a family might never come true.
But yesterday she stunned them all by marrying musical star Lee Mead on a beach in the Seychelles.
The couple met when Denise, 35, was a judge on BBC1’s Any Dream Will Do talent show, which 27-year-old Lee won, landing the lead role in the musical Joseph And The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at.
Last night a friend said: ‘Denise went away last weekend telling people she was simply going on holiday.
'It was literally just her parents, his parents and a couple of her best pals.’

Wearing an strapless white dress, her hair tied back with a Seventies-style band, Denise could scarcely contain her joy during the ceremony – held in full view of other guests at the Labriz Silhouette luxury resort.

Afterwards the happy couple were seen kissing on a boat.
The pair stayed for ten nights in the two-storey Presidential villa at a cost of £12,000. It is the most expensive room in the hotel and has its own pool.
The simple ceremony marked the end of her much-troubled search for the right man. Despite once being labelled a ‘ladette’, Denise has described herself as ‘a traditional girl at heart’.
She said: ‘I come from a big family, my parents are still together and I’m so girly, I dream of the white wedding and the big dress.’
Her longest relationship was with the singer Jay Kay of Jamiroquai, to whom she was engaged. They split up in 2001 and Denise later dated nightclub owner Richard Traviss.

Then she enjoyed a short romance with old flame James Lance, who was a fellow Sylvia Young stage school student.

She and Lee say they started dating in November 2007, although his ex-girlfriend Kerry Stammers has claimed their relationship was kept secret for months.
Lee previously said: ‘Denise and I clicked instantly. We had the same sense of humour, but also we could be silent with each other.
‘I knew at once it was right. She is very down to earth.’
